Here are the top 5 stories today in Shirley-Mastic:
- Teacher and sculptor Frank Porcu, from Mastic Beach, showcased his talents on a President Abraham Lincoln sculpture first displayed on April 6 at the New York Historical Society in Manhattan. The sculpture received numerous positive reviews from the historians who participated in the event. (Newsday/Subscription Required)
- A home fire on Mastic Boulevard left one person injured. According to police, the fire started in the kitchen, but no confirmation of the cause of the fire was released. The victim was transported to Stony Brook Hospital by helicopter to be treated. (Patch)

- Christian Guardino of Patchogue performed in Hawaii on Monday and made it to the top 24 on 'American Idol.' The singer now hopes to get enough votes to make it to the top 20. (Patchogue Patch)
- Long Island cardiologist Trevor Verga was found dead on Tuesday after being reported missing by family members. Verga was 45 years old and resided in Kings Park, the cause of death appears to be non-criminal. (Patch)
